You can clean your house effectively and naturally using these simple yet powerful remedies:
White Vinegar:
All-purpose cleaner: Mix equal parts water and white vinegar in a spray bottle. It cuts through grease and grime on most surfaces.
Window cleaner: Dilute vinegar with water for streak-free shine.
Deodorizer: Place bowls of vinegar in smelly areas to absorb odors.
Baking Soda:
Scouring powder: Sprinkle on spills and scrub with a damp sponge.
Deodorizer: Place open boxes of baking soda in the refrigerator or other areas to absorb odors.
Cleaning paste: Mix with water to create a paste for tougher stains.
Lemon:
Disinfectant: Lemon juice has natural antibacterial properties.
Deodorizer: Place lemon peels in the garbage disposal to freshen it up.
Cleaner: Use lemon juice to clean and brighten cutting boards.
